Meanings in research on corruption

Abstract This article aims to give an overview of the accumulated discussions about corruption, identifying and gathering its main occurrences in scientific research. The texts found during the literature review process reveal the heterogeneous and asymmetrical character of scientific literature on the subject. From the scarce or barely existing number of articles devoted exclusively to the literature review on corruption to the multitude of texts that tackle its causes, effects and perception, the subject is approached with different interests in the scientific community. This article aims to contribute to Public Administration studies by identifying the senses of research on corruption and organizing them into six groups or thematic axes.
